What to Know Before Buying in Spokane Valley
- Zoning: Spokane Valley zoning supports accessory dwelling units (ADUs) on residential lots, but check for 5-10 foot setbacks and HOA restrictions in suburban neighborhoods to ensure compliance for tiny homes.
- Permits: Secure building permits through Spokane County, which reviews tiny home plans for safety and code adherence; ADU approvals often take 4-6 weeks.
- Delivery: Delivery logistics favor wide alleyways and flat lots in Spokane Valley’s suburban layout; coordinate with haulers for access to backyard placements avoiding urban congestion.
- Financing: Standard RV or personal loans apply, with no specific city grants; explore Washington state programs for eco-friendly tiny home purchases to ease affordability.
- Customization: Tailor tiny homes to fit Spokane Valley’s compact urban lots, enhancing backyard access or adding rental-friendly features like energy-efficient upgrades for local appeal.
Frequently Asked Questions
Can I place a tiny home on my property in Spokane Valley?
Spokane Valley has mixed zoning regulations for tiny homes, with Park Models and A-Frames being the most accepted options on private land as accessory dwelling units. Tiny homes on wheels (THOWs) may face stricter city zoning or RV restrictions, so check local codes before placement.
Can I use it as an Airbnb?
Yes, tiny homes can serve as Airbnbs in high-demand areas like downtown Spokane zones, near Gonzaga University, and around major hospitals such as Providence Sacred Heart Medical Center. Event drivers like the Spokane County Interstate Fair boost tourism potential in these spots.
